一、前言二、性能测试对比三、12种转换案例1. get\set2. json2Json3. Apache copyProperties4. Spring copyProperties5. Bean Mapping6. Bean Mapping ASM7. BeanCopier8. Orika9. Dozer10. ModelMapper11. JMapper12. MapStruct四、总结五、系
Python中List, Tuple, dict, set 的比较1. List2. Tuple3. dict4. setOverview 参照廖雪峰官方网站链接: 廖雪峰Python教程.1. Listlist是一种有序的集合,可以随时添加和删除其中的元素。列出班里所有同学的名字,就可以用一个list表示:下面以一个例子来说明一些List的操作classmates = ['Wang', 'Ca
转载
2024-09-20 07:19:13
17阅读
## Java 8 List对象属性转Map
在Java开发中,我们经常会遇到将List对象中的属性转换为Map的需求。Java 8引入了一些新的特性,使得这个任务变得非常简单。本文将介绍使用Java 8的新特性来实现List对象属性转Map的方法,并提供相应示例代码。
### 1. 需求分析
假设我们有一个包含学生信息的List,每个学生对象包含学生的ID和姓名。我们希望将这个List转换
原创
2024-01-28 09:52:39
266阅读
# Java List转Map多属性拼接实现方法
## 1. 概述
在Java中,List是一种常见的数据结构,而Map也是一种常用的数据结构,用于存储键值对。有时候我们需要将一个List中的对象转换为一个Map,并根据对象的多个属性进行拼接。本文将介绍如何实现这个功能。
## 2. 实现步骤
下面是整个实现过程的步骤,我们将使用一个示例来说明具体的代码实现:
| 步骤 | 描述 |
|
原创
2024-01-03 04:28:12
347阅读
在 Java 的发展过程中,常常需要将`List`对象转换成`Map`。如果我们有一个包含多个对象的`List`,并希望根据某一属性将这些对象整理成一个`Map`,该如何实施呢?下面我将详细记录这一过程,并阐述在过程中需要的各项策略和实现方案。
### 备份策略
在实施转换操作之前,我们需要制定一个备份策略,以防数据丢失。我们的备份策略可以用思维导图呈现,帮助更好地理解和规划所有步骤。
``
一、BeanUtils组件1、简介 ① 程序中对javabean的操作很频繁, 所以apache提供了一套开源的api,方便对javabean的操作!即BeanUtils组件。 ② BeanUtils组件, 作用是简化javabean的操作! ③ 用户可以从www.apache.org下载BeanUtils组件,然后再在项目中引入jar文件!2、使用BenUtils组件 ① 引入commons-b
转载
2024-07-07 11:46:23
26阅读
Java bean 转 Map 时需要使用Fastjson 另外也可以使用 使用 BeanUtils 实际例子如下: 运行的代码如下: 输出的结果如下:
转载
2019-03-24 02:37:00
284阅读
2评论
# 将 Java Bean 转换为 Map 的实现指南
Java Bean 是一种遵循特定约定的类,用于封装数据。如果你希望将这些数据以 Map 格式进行处理,理解如何将 Java Bean 转换为 Map 是非常有必要的。本文将指导你完成这一过程,我们将通过简单的步骤和代码示例来帮助你。
## 1. 整体流程
为了清晰地理解整个过程,我们将整个实现分为几个步骤。以下是步骤的概述:
| 步
原创
2024-08-06 06:49:24
24阅读
# Java Bean 转 Map
在Java中,我们经常会用到Java Bean这个概念。Java Bean是一种符合特定规范的Java类,通常用于封装数据。而有时候,我们需要将Java Bean中的数据转换为Map格式,以便于处理或传输数据。本文将介绍如何将Java Bean转换为Map,并提供代码示例。
## Java Bean
Java Bean是一种符合特定规范的Java类,其特点
原创
2024-02-28 05:23:06
73阅读
public class BeanMapUtils { /** *
原创
2023-02-14 08:47:31
112阅读
一、将Bean转成MapObjectMapper objectMapper = new ObjectMappe
原创
2022-08-05 05:48:13
373阅读
# Java Bean 转 Map
## 导言
Java Bean 是一种符合特定规范的 Java 类,用于封装数据。通常情况下,我们需要将 Java Bean 对象转换为 Map 对象,以便在不同层之间传递数据。本文将详细介绍如何将 Java Bean 对象转换为 Map 对象,并提供相应的代码示例。
## 什么是 Java Bean?
Java Bean 是一种符合特定规范的普通 Ja
原创
2023-10-08 11:12:33
123阅读
# Java Map 转 Bean 实现指南
作为一名经验丰富的开发者,我经常被问到如何将 `Java` 中的 `Map` 对象转换为 `Bean` 对象。这个问题对于初学者来说可能有些复杂,但不用担心,我会一步一步教你如何实现这个功能。
## 一、流程概述
首先,我们需要了解整个流程。下面是一个简单的流程表,展示了从 `Map` 到 `Bean` 的转换过程:
| 步骤 | 描述 |
|
原创
2024-07-23 06:36:35
268阅读
# Java Bean转Map
## 简介
本文将介绍如何将Java Bean对象转换为Map对象。Java Bean是指符合特定规范的Java类,具有私有属性、公共的getter和setter方法的类。Map是一种键值对的数据结构,可以方便地存储和访问数据。
## 流程概览
下面是将Java Bean转换为Map的步骤概览:
| 步骤 | 描述 |
| --- | --- |
| 1 |
原创
2023-09-24 08:14:12
1031阅读
使用Spring框架时,我们经常会在xml文件里装配bean。今天我们认识一下bean元素里的属性都有着哪些用处。<bean abstract="true" autowire-candidate="default" autowire="default"
class="" dependency-check="default" depends-on="" destroy-meth
转载
2024-04-11 08:13:12
36阅读
## Java Bean 转 List:一个简单的指南
在Java开发中,Java Bean 是一种通用的Java类,它遵循特定的编写规范。通过将数据从一个Java Bean转换为List,可以方便地处理和操作数据。本文将通过代码示例和图示化的流程,为您详细讲解这种转换过程。
### Java Bean的基本特点
Java Bean 是一个可重用的组件,通常遵循以下几个标准:
1. 必须有
# 从Java List转换为Bean的实现方法
## 一、流程概述
我们将通过以下步骤来实现Java List转换为Bean:
```mermaid
journey
title Java List转Bean实现流程
section 1. 创建Bean类
section 2. 创建List数据
section 3. 使用BeanUtils类进行转换
```
#
原创
2024-04-18 03:21:47
806阅读
# 如何实现“java8 list 提取属性转map”
## 第一步:导入需要的类
在开始实现之前,首先导入需要使用的类。
```java
import java.util.List;
import java.util.stream.Collectors;
import java.util.Map;
```
## 第二步:定义实体类
定义一个实体类,用来存储列表中的元素。
```jav
原创
2024-07-06 05:59:38
214阅读
前言最近开始负责一个数据量比较大的业务模块,要求把相关数据全部查出来,不分页,要组树结构,数据从dao层到service由entity对象到Vo对象给前端展示。那么就涉及到对象拷贝,开始的时候用的Spring的BeanUtils做对象转换,并没有什么问题,后来到了测试那里,加大数据量,发现接口越来越慢,开始以为数据库查询问题,把sql搬到数据库运行,发现并不慢,因为关键字段基本都走了索引,不会很慢
转载
2024-08-02 15:23:10
219阅读
一、在Java中,可以通过以下方法将实体类转换为Map:利用Java反射机制:public static Map<String, Object> objectToMap(Object obj) throws IllegalAccessException {
Map<String, Object> map = new HashMap<>();
Class<?
原创
2024-06-12 11:55:49
127阅读